I always find it useful to do a Currency Strength Analysis before I look for trade setups. Basically you compare a base currency, i.e. AUD, against the other currencies and then open the charts where the base currency is strongest, and look for trade setups in favor of the base currency. For example right now the AUD is very strong against the NZD and GBP.
